#8c6233 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8c6233 is composed of 54.9% red, 38.4%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30% magenta, 63.6%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 31.7 degrees, a saturation of 46.6% and a lightness of 37.5%. #8c6233 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c466 with #190000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#8c6233

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0704 is the darkest color, while #fefc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#8c6233

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#60605f is the less saturated color, while #b86407 is the most saturated one.
